Background System Updates You Did Not Notice
Windows and macOS both run silent updates in the background. Driver patches, security updates, and system configuration changes can be installed automatically while your laptop is idle or charging. You wake up the next morning, open your laptop, and something feels different. Technically, something did change. You just were not aware of it. Microsoft reported that many user-reported glitch spikes coincide with Patch Tuesday, the monthly cycle where Windows pushes security updates automatically.
Thermal Stress and Hardware Ageing
Your laptop generates heat every single time you use it. Over months and years, the internal components expand and contract with temperature changes. This process, called thermal cycling, gradually wears down solder joints on the motherboard, loosens connections, and degrades the performance of memory chips. Even if you never dropped your laptop or spilt anything on it, the simple act of using it regularly causes microscopic physical changes inside. These changes often trigger software-level glitches because the CPU or RAM cannot maintain stable communication with the rest of the system.
A common real-world example is the 2011 MacBook Pro GPU failure. Apple acknowledged that thermal stress caused the graphics chip to lose connection with the motherboard, producing random freezes and visual artefacts. No user had done anything wrong. No changes had been made. The hardware had simply aged under normal use.
Memory Leaks in Long-Running Applications
RAM, or random access memory, is your laptop’s short-term memory. When you open a browser with 20 tabs, a video call app, a PDF editor, and a music player all at once, each program uses a portion of RAM. The problem is that some applications have what developers call a memory leak, where they slowly consume more RAM over time without releasing it when they are done. If you leave your laptop running for days without restarting, available memory shrinks until the system starts stuttering, freezing, or behaving erratically. You made no changes. The glitch was simply the result of accumulated memory pressure.
Corrupt System Files Triggering Errors
Operating systems rely on thousands of system files working together in perfect coordination. A sudden power cut, a forced shutdown during an update, or even a bad sector developing on your hard drive can corrupt one or more of these files. Once corrupted, they cause unpredictable errors that seem completely random because the damage is hidden beneath the surface. You might notice applications crashing, error codes appearing, or your startup process behaving strangely.
Background Processes and Conflicting Software
Even when you are not actively using your laptop, dozens of background processes are running. Antivirus scans, cloud sync services, scheduled diagnostics, and app update checkers all compete for processing power. Occasionally, two background processes conflict with each other, causing one to malfunction. This type of software conflict shows up as a glitch that looks random because you cannot see the processes fighting each other behind the scenes.
Failing Storage Drive
A hard drive or SSD that is starting to fail will often produce glitches long before it completely stops working. You might notice programs taking longer to load, files becoming unresponsive, or your system hanging for several seconds. These are early warning signs of read/write errors on your storage device. Because modern drives have built-in error correction, they mask the early failures well, which is why the glitches can seem random and inconsistent.
Practical Troubleshooting Steps You Can Try at Home
Restart your laptop properly. A full restart, not just closing the lid, clears RAM, ends background processes, and refreshes system connections. This alone fixes a surprisingly large number of random glitches.
Check for pending updates manually. Go into your system settings and look for any updates that might be queued or partially installed. Completing those updates often resolves the instability.
Run a disk health check. On Windows, use the built-in CHKDSK tool to scan your drive for errors. On a Mac, use Disk Utility and run First Aid. These tools identify and sometimes repair file system corruption.
Monitor your system temperature. Download a free tool like HWMonitor on Windows or iStatMenus on Mac to check your CPU and GPU temperatures. If your laptop is running hotter than 85 to 90 degrees Celsius under normal use, poor ventilation or a failing fan could be causing thermal throttling, which looks like random slowdowns.
Check your RAM. Windows users can run the built-in Windows Memory Diagnostic tool. On a Mac, run Apple Diagnostics by holding the D key during startup. Faulty RAM produces a wide range of strange behaviours that are easily mistaken for software problems.
Free up startup applications. Too many programs launching at startup bog down your system before you even open a single app. On Windows, open Task Manager and disable unnecessary startup items. On Mac, go to System Settings and manage your Login Items.
When to Seek Professional Help
Some situations go beyond what a home troubleshooter can safely fix. If your laptop is showing any of the following signs, it is worth having a qualified technician look at it:
The glitches are getting worse over time rather than improving. You are seeing visual artefacts like coloured lines, screen flashing, or parts of the display going black. Your laptop is making unusual clicking or grinding sounds. It shuts down on its own regularly, especially during moderate tasks. The device overheats to the point where it is uncomfortable to touch.
These symptoms often point to hardware-level problems that need physical inspection and repair.
Frequently Asked Questions
Q: Can a laptop glitch without any hardware problem?
A: Yes. Software conflicts, memory leaks, corrupt system files, and background update processes can all cause glitches on a laptop that has perfectly healthy hardware.
Q: Does restarting a laptop fix random glitches?
A: Restarting clears memory, closes background processes, and re-establishes system connections. It resolves many common glitches, but not issues caused by hardware failure or deep file corruption.
Q: How do I know if my laptop glitch is hardware or software?
A: If glitches disappear after a restart and stay away for a while, it is likely software. If they return quickly, worsen over time, or involve visual distortion and unexpected shutdowns, hardware is more likely involved.
Q: Why does my laptop glitch more when it is hot?
A: Heat causes components to expand and can trigger thermal throttling, where the CPU deliberately slows down to protect itself. Sustained high temperatures also accelerate hardware degradation over time.
Q: Can a failing hard drive cause random software glitches?
A: Yes. A drive with developing bad sectors struggles to read and write data correctly, causing application errors, system hangs, and file corruption that all appear as random glitches.
